Seven hundred years of history etched in bronze. That’s what the Korablik sculpture represents here in Saint Petersburg. This isn’t just any monument. It’s a poignant reminder of Peter the Great’s ambitious shipbuilding endeavors.

The Korablik a small seemingly unassuming sculpture holds a powerful story. It commemorates the early days of Saint Petersburg’s naval power. Peter the Great a visionary leader understood the strategic importance of a strong navy. He personally oversaw the construction of many ships. The original Korablik was unfortunately lost during the turbulent 1930s. However a remarkable replica was donated to the city in 1997. This gift from the Netherlands stands as a testament to enduring international friendship.
